> You don’t tell us; are you using Yahoo! as your price source? Yahoo! dismembered its quote source website a while back, and GnuCash users have had to seek out other sources. One source is AlphaVantage, while another is “Yahoo! as JSON”. If you set up your accounts to use one of these (preferably the latter), do you still get the errors?
>
> Note: you will need Finance::Quote verson 1.47; if you want to use AlphaVantage, there are instructions on the wiki; I believe that the FAQ has links to the instructions.

>> Hello to all. I have GnuCash 2.6.15 installed on my MX18 and all works fine
>> except the Get quotes price updater. I get an error message "There was an
>> unknown error while retrieving the price quotes." I've toyed with this for
>> hours and installed everything I could find on the net to no avail.
>>
>> I can see the finance quote module load at start up but I cannot get a box
>> to show up to even change my data source. I am a user from long ago and the
>> program is awesome and the price updater has worked in years past. This is a
>> new computer and new OS install but I'v tried to confirm I have all modules
>> installed and as far as I know, everything is in place but won't work.
>>
>> I also upgraded to a much newer version and not only didn't price updater
>> not work, the new asset values was completely different from the older
>> version. I lost money. So I uninstalled and went back to this older version.
>> Any thoughts would be greatly appreciated. I am manually updating about a
>> dozen quotes.
